Start Your Ebusiness

With the financial problems we are all facing right now, many people are turning to the internet in the hope of being able to earn a living that way.

Starting an online business or ebusiness is quite easy to do in principle. There are no overhead costs and start up costs are minimal. The most common type of business on the internet is Internet Marketing or IM, as this is the simplest, requiring no stock of physical products.

However it is a very steep learning curve and pretty difficult to succeed.

There is so much information out there, in fact there is too much, leading to information overload and you can end up spending a lot of money just trying to learn it all.
